+### Build Procedure Change for Auto Tools
+
+You can ignore this if you are using CMake or one of the win32 build
+methods.
+
+As of release 2.10.32 the release archive file will no longer contain
+the result of running `autoreconf`. This places a new requirement on
+the target platform, that `autoreconf` and friends are installed. This
+should not be an issue for most users. If it is, you can roll your own
+auto-tooled version by untarring the distribution and running
+`autoreconf` in its root directory as follows:
+
+```sh
+autoreconf -if
+./configure --enable-freedist --enable-as-02
+make
+make dist
+```

+## Libraries
+
+`libkumu.dylib` - Platform compatibility layer.
+
+`libasdcp.dylib` - SMPTE ST 429 (DCP) and JPEG Interop DCP.
+
+`libas02.dylib` - SMPTE ST 2067 (IMF).
+
+`libphdr.dylib` - Dolby Vision track file. Deprecated but maintained.
